sql >> Databáze >  >> RDS >> Sqlserver

Co je SQL Server?

SQL Server je systém pro správu relačních databází (RDBMS) vyvinutý společností Microsoft. Jedná se o nabídku RDBMS na podnikové úrovni společnosti Microsoft a je to sofistikovanější a robustnější systém než Access, který byl tradičně stolním systémem.

Hlavními konkurenty SQL Serveru jsou Oracle Database, MySQL (nyní ve vlastnictví Oracle), PostgreSQL a DB2 od IBM.

SQL Server je systém založený na klient-server, což znamená, že funguje jako server, který obvykle obsahuje mnoho databází, přičemž k databázím přistupuje více klientů z celé sítě. Těmito klienty jsou často jiné aplikace (například webové stránky nebo CRM systém). To je na rozdíl od stolních systémů, kde bude databáze často (ale ne nutně) umístěna v počítači uživatele.

Systémy založené na klient-server mají obvykle mnohem vyšší specifikace než stolní systémy, a to platí při porovnávání SQL Server a Access.

Zde je několik příkladů pro ilustraci rozdílu:

  • Databáze SQL Server 2016 může mít maximální velikost 524 272 terabajtů zatímco databáze Accessu 2016 může mít maximální velikost 2 gigabajty .
  • Každá instance SQL Server 2016 umožňuje maximálně 32 767 současných uživatelských připojení zatímco databáze Access 2016 má limit 255 souběžných uživatelů .

SQL Server Management Studio

SQL Server je dodáván s SQL Server Management Studio, což je grafická konzole, která vám umožňuje vyvíjet, konfigurovat a spravovat váš SQL Server.

Mnoho úloh lze provádět buď prostřednictvím GUI, nebo programově spuštěním SQL dotazu z karty dotazů.

Technologie/služby SQL Server

SQL Server se skládá z různých technologií a služeb. Zde jsou ty, které tvoří SQL Server 2016.

Databázový stroj

Database Engine je základní službou pro ukládání, zpracování a zabezpečení dat.

Služby R

R Services poskytuje dvě serverové platformy pro integraci oblíbeného open source jazyka R s podnikovými aplikacemi:SQL Server R Services (In-Database) pro integraci se serverem SQL Server a Microsoft R Server.

Jazyk R je široce používán mezi statistiky a těžaři dat pro vývoj statistického softwaru a analýzy dat.

Služby kvality dat

Služby kvality dat (DQS) se používají k čištění dat pomocí systému znalostní báze.

Služby integrace

Integration Services je platforma pro integraci dat a transformace dat.

Hlavní datové služby

Master Data Services umožňuje organizaci vytvářet a spravovat důvěryhodnou verzi dat, jak se v průběhu času mění.

Služby analýzy

Analysis Services je řešení pro datové sklady společnosti Microsoft.

Replikace

Replikace je sada technologií pro kopírování a distribuci dat a databázových objektů z jedné databáze do druhé a následnou synchronizaci mezi databázemi pro zachování konzistence.

Služby hlášení

Reporting Services umožňuje vytvářet sestavy z různých zdrojů dat, publikovat sestavy v různých formátech a centrálně spravovat zabezpečení a předplatné.


  1. Jak vytvořit alias datového typu definovaného uživatelem na serveru SQL pomocí T-SQL

  2. SQL Server Textový typ vs. datový typ varchar

  3. Jak deklarovat uživatelsky definovanou výjimku pomocí proměnné výjimky v databázi Oracle

  4. Západka FGCB_ADD_REMOVE